75th Anniversary of NSS

  • The Ministry of Statistics and Program Implementation (MoSPI) celebrated the 75th anniversary of the National Sample Surveys (NSS).
  • In 1950, the National Sample Survey Directorate was established in the Ministry of Finance.
  • In 1957, the directorate was transferred to the cabinet secretariat.
  • In 1970, it became a part of the National Statistics Service of the Ministry of Planning’s Department of Statistics.
  • It has been under the newly formed Ministry of Statistics and Programme Implementation since 1999 (MOSPI).
  • The Ministry has two wings - one relates to Statistics and the other is Programme Implementation.
  • The Statistics Wing called the National Statistical Office (NSO) consists of the
    • Central Statistical Office (CSO),
    • The Computer Center and
    • The National Sample Survey Office (NSSO).
